Separate input/output handling in BufferProcessors.
This allows BufferProcessors to partially and/or asynchronously handle input/output. Document contract for queueInput and getOutput. Update ResamplingBufferProcessor to use the new interface. Separate submitting bytes vs. writing data to the AudioTrack. ------------- Created by MOE: https://github.com/google/moe MOE_MIGRATED_REVID=148212269
